Why El Paso Homes Are Different

El Paso sits where the Franklin Mountains meet the Chihuahuan Desert, and that geography shapes every garage door we service. The 50+ mph spring windstorms compressed through mountain passes rack panels and snap cables. Caliche-laced dust packs bottom seals into abrasive paste that destroys rollers and track finish. Thermal cycling from 100°F afternoons to 70°F nights fatigues springs faster than in humid Texas climates. And UV exposure among the highest in the continental US cracks rubber seals in 2-3 years instead of 5-7. These are not abstract climate facts. They’re the reason a 1960s ranch on Pershing Drive needs different care than a comparable home in Houston.

Roller and Track Work

Caliche dust turns bottom seals into sandpaper against steel rollers. Rollers that should last seven years often grind flat in two to three. We replace them with sealed-bearing hardware that resists grit intrusion, and we inspect track finish for galling caused by that white mineral paste. Roller replacement in El Paso typically costs $110-$220. Track realignment, often needed after windstorms bend hardware, runs $120-$240.

Why do garage door springs and rollers wear out so fast in El Paso?

El Paso’s combination of caliche dust, extreme thermal cycling, and intense UV exposure accelerates wear on every moving part. The 25-30°F overnight temperature swings after 100°F days repeatedly stress torsion springs, while caliche dust packs bottom seals and grinds rollers into the track. Opener Repair

The most common call we get: the motor hums but the door does not move, or the opener runs but the chain slips. Often the gear sprocket is stripped from years of lifting a door with a fatigued spring. Sometimes the limit switch contacts have oxidized from thermal cycling. Opener repair in El Paso typically costs $120-$320, and we replace the failed component rather than pushing a full replacement.

Cables and Drums

Cables snap when windstorms rack the door panel, or when grit-packed drums create uneven lift that frays the wire strand by strand. The March-April wind season, with gusts exceeding 50 mph through Franklin Mountain passes, is the single biggest cause of cable failure we see. Cable repair in El Paso typically runs $130-$250. We always inspect drum grooves for caliche dust scoring that will destroy the next cable if left uncorrected.

What should I do if my garage door blows off track during a spring windstorm?

Disconnect the opener by pulling the red emergency release cord, then leave the door alone. A door off track is under uneven tension and can drop or twist without warning.
